Initial Cleaning Steps
Getting rid of cat pee smell from your bed starts with quick action. It’s crucial to tackle the issue as soon as possible to prevent stains and lingering odors.
Blotting the Area
Blotting is the first step. Use paper towels or a clean cloth to absorb as much liquid as possible. Press down firmly but don’t rub; rubbing can spread the urine further into the fibers. Do this until the cloth stays mostly dry. I remember the time Ginger had an accident on my bed. I grabbed every towel in sight to soak up what I could—trust me, quick action helps.
Avoiding Common Mistakes
Avoid using ammonia-based cleaners. They can actually intensify the smell because cat urine contains ammonia. Stick to enzyme-based cleaners specifically designed for pet messes. These products break down the proteins and compounds in cat urine, making them much more effective. Always test cleaners on a hidden area first to ensure they won’t damage your bedding.

Homemade Solutions
White vinegar works wonders. Mix one part vinegar with one part water, then spray it on the affected area. This combo neutralizes odors instantly. After letting it sit for 10-15 minutes, blot the area dry.
Baking soda is another great option. Sprinkle it over the wet area after treating with vinegar. Let it sit overnight to absorb lingering smells, then vacuum it up. I’ve seen it go from smelly to fresh overnight!

Steam Cleaning
Steam cleaning works wonders on cat urine odors. The high temperature penetrates deep into the mattress, killing bacteria and breaking down odor-causing compounds. I once used a steam cleaner after Ginger had an accident on my bed. The smell vanished instantly!
To steam clean, fill your machine with water. Set it to the appropriate temperature and slowly move it over the affected area. Make sure to ventilate the space afterwards, as moisture can create a breeding ground for mold if left damp for too long.

Litter Box Maintenance
Maintaining a clean litter box makes a big difference. I scoop the litter daily to keep the box fresh. Studies show that 60% of cat owners don’t clean their litter boxes often enough, which can lead to accidents. I use clumping cat litter, making it easy to dispose of waste and keep the smell down. Regularly replacing the litter every week helps too.
